592d439efe [X86] Avoid emitting unnecessary test instructions.
This patch teaches the backend how to check for the 'NoSignedWrap' flag on
binary operations to improve the emission of 'test' instructions.

If the result of a binary operation is known not to overflow we know that
resetting the Overflow flag is unnecessary and so we can avoid emitting
the test instruction.

a2bc6951a0 [X86] Use ADD/SUB instead of INC/DEC for Silvermont
According to Intel Software Optimization Manual 
on Silvermont INC or DEC instructions require 
an additional uop to merge the flags.
As a result, a branch instruction depending 
on an INC or a DEC instruction incurs a 1 cycle penalty.

5d0f7af3dc Add a new attribute called 'jumptable' that creates jump-instruction tables for functions marked with this attribute.
It includes a pass that rewrites all indirect calls to jumptable functions to pass through these tables.

This also adds backend support for generating the jump-instruction tables on ARM and X86.
Note that since the jumptable attribute creates a second function pointer for a
function, any function marked with jumptable must also be marked with unnamed_addr.

1726e2ff15 [X86] Add two combine rules to simplify dag nodes introduced during type legalization when promoting nodes with illegal vector type.
This patch teaches the backend how to simplify/canonicalize dag node
sequences normally introduced by the backend when promoting certain dag nodes
with illegal vector type.

This patch adds two new combine rules:
1) fold (shuffle (bitcast (BINOP A, B)), Undef, <Mask>) ->
        (shuffle (BINOP (bitcast A), (bitcast B)), Undef, <Mask>)

2) fold (BINOP (shuffle (A, Undef, <Mask>)), (shuffle (B, Undef, <Mask>))) ->
        (shuffle (BINOP A, B), Undef, <Mask>).

Both rules are only triggered on the type-legalized DAG.
In particular, rule 1. is a target specific combine rule that attempts
to sink a bitconvert into the operands of a binary operation.
Rule 2. is a target independet rule that attempts to move a shuffle
immediately after a binary operation.

7cd893a985 [X86] Remove AVX1 vbroadcast intrinsics
The corresponding CFE patch replaces these intrinsics with vector initializers
in avxintrin.h.  This patch removes the LLVM intrinsics from the backend.

We now stop lowering at X86ISD::VBROADCAST custom node rather than lowering
that further to the intrinsics.

The patch only changes VBROADCASTS* and leaves VBROADCAST[FI]128 to continue
to use intrinsics.  As explained in the CFE patch, the reason is that we
currently don't generate as good code for them without the intrinsics.

CodeGen/X86/avx-vbroadcast.ll already provides coverage for this change.  It
checks that for a series of insertelements we generate the appropriate
vbroadcast instruction.

Also verified that there was no assembly change in the test-suite before and
after this patch.

fd0096a42c [X86] Fix a bug in the lowering of BLENDI introduced in r209043.
ISD::VSELECT mask uses 1 to identify the first argument and 0 to identify the
second argument.
On the other hand, BLENDI uses 0 to identify the first argument and 1 to
identify the second argument.
Fix the generation of the blend mask to account for this difference.

The bug did not show up with r209043, because we were not checking for the
actual arguments of the blend instruction!
This commit also fixes the test cases.

Note: The same mask works for the BLENDr variant because the arguments are
swapped during instruction selection (see the BLENDXXrr patterns).

0d0bab5168 [X86] Tune LEA usage for Silvermont
According to Intel Software Optimization Manual on Silvermont in some cases LEA
is better to be replaced with ADD instructions:
"The rule of thumb for ADDs and LEAs is that it is justified to use LEA
with a valid index and/or displacement for non-destructive destination purposes
(especially useful for stack offset cases), or to use a SCALE.
Otherwise, ADD(s) are preferable."

8e4a223f7b [X86] Add ISel patterns to improve the selection of TZCNT and LZCNT.
Instructions TZCNT (requires BMI1) and LZCNT (requires LZCNT), always
provide the operand size as output if the input operand is zero.

We can take advantage of this knowledge during instruction selection
stage in order to simplify a few corner case.

bb81d9d5fa SDAG: Legalize vector BSWAP into a shuffle if the shuffle is legal but the bswap not.
- On ARM/ARM64 we get a vrev because the shuffle matching code is really smart. We still unroll anything that's not v4i32 though.
- On X86 we get a pshufb with SSSE3. Required more cleverness in isShuffleMaskLegal.
- On PPC we get a vperm for v8i16 and v4i32. v2i64 is unrolled.
